Secularism, Religious Difference, and the Modern Nation State

This chapter explores the impact of the modern nation state on religious identity in Muslim societies, particularly in the Middle East. The speaker discusses the rise of explicit forms of public religiosity and the historical developments that led to this phenomenon. They examine the central argument of their book, which focuses on how the modern nation state has transformed the practice of religion, and explore the connection between secularism and religious difference.
